Publisher's Synopsis

A swashbuckling adventure story, based on the character in Isabel Allende's novel, ZORRO, but imagining his childhood adventures.

When cattle start to go missing from the de la Vega's ranch, and skilled workmen disappear from the local villages, it is clear that something mysterious is going on. But Diego (the young Zorro) and his brother Bernardo are determined to get to the bottom of the mystery… and soon become embroiled in an exciting and dangerous conspiracy.

An exciting action-adventure story about the childhood of Zorro and his sidekick Bernardo. This novel is based on the character in Isabel Allende's novel ZORRO - in which she imagines Zorro's childhood. Zorro is an imaginary character who was invented at the beginning of the twentieth century - half Hispanic and half Native American - and the book is set in Southern California in the late nineteenth century.

The author Jan Adkins helped Isabel Allende with the research for her novel, which was published in the UK in May 2005. Allende's name will appear on the jacket.
